## Gatemarrow rate limiting — quick tour

Hey, welcome to the review. Gatemarrow (our internal API gateway) enforces per-team token buckets: 200 rps default, bursts to 500 for allowlisted services. Limits live in a signed config bundle so nobody can bump their own quota sneakily. The gateway rejects any bundle that fails verification. Bundles are validated against the deploy key below.

signing key of bagap-yawep = bky13_TbfT6ZMUoGJo2

## Hermetic Build Migration — Provenance Notes

Welcome! We're moving the Copperline services off the old shared-runner builds onto Forgepit, our hermetic build system. Short version: every artifact now carries signed provenance, so no more "it built on my laptop" mysteries. When verifying an artifact, compare its provenance stamp against the canonical token below.

build token for kagaf-hahof: htk14_9d3d4d26d7d8de

- [ ] **Step 7: Breaker override escrow.** After sealing the signing keys for the Tallgrove upstream API circuit breaker, confirm the support team can force the breaker open during a full outage. The override bundle lives in the sealed escrow drawer and is useless without its unlock phrase. Two ceremony witnesses must initial this step before proceeding. The escrow bundle is decrypted with the recovery passphrase that follows.

vault phrase of kahip-kahop = holath-quenmir

Welcome to the team. The Stillbrook migration runner, which applies schema changes with zero downtime using the expand-contract pattern, failed last night because its credential for the internal Ledgerton metadata service expired. Until it authenticates, no migrations can advance past the expand phase, and the pending contract step for the orders table is on hold. Nothing is broken in production, but we should restore access promptly. A replacement credential has been issued and should be placed in the runner's secrets file.

service key, fawip-bajef: kto11_Qt5wZK9vdNC